Transaction 614dc605384a57a90201f4f2f1e082b023a0a38ebf0d3e9309895839c1698d04
1 Input
1 Output
-
614dc605384a57a90201f4f2f1e082b023a0a38ebf0d3e9309895839c1698d04:0
- value
- 331880
- script pubkey
- OP_0 OP_PUSHBYTES_20 51680fa7e841b6a55c113b8b3d5b2481a2149582
- address
- bc1q295qlflggxm22hq38w9n6keysx3pf9vz9a3cls